  • Multi-Channel Fulfillment (MCF)

    Multi-Channel Fulfillment (MCF) enables Amazon sellers to use Amazon’s fulfillment centers for orders from various sales channels, enhancing shipping speed and reliability. This service simplifies inventory management and streamlines operations, boosting customer satisfaction and sales.

  • Delivery Window Compliance

    Delivery Window Compliance is vital for Amazon sellers, ensuring timely shipping and delivery of products. Adhering to specified timeframes boosts seller ratings, enhances customer satisfaction, and prevents penalties, fostering trust on the platform.

  • Amazon Delivery SLA (Service Level Agreement)

    The Amazon Delivery SLA (Service Level Agreement) defines delivery timelines and service quality for sellers. Adhering to these standards is essential for maintaining seller ratings, customer satisfaction, and avoiding penalties that can impact sales performance.
